基于小波分解的纹理分割的农机化应用研究

摘    要:农业机械自动导航是农业自动化的重要标志之一,其中图像分割技术已成为农业机械导航的重要环节.为此,根据已收割和未收割的农作物图像具有不同纹理特征的性质,采用小波分解方法,对农作物图像的自动分割进行了大量实验研究,并且与纹理分割常用的Laws能量特征法进行了实验效果和运行效率对比.理论分析和实验结果均表明:基于小波分解的纹理分割方法,完全适用于农业机械导航中的农作物图像自动分割.

Resarch of Wavelet Based Texture Segmentation for Agricultural Machanization Application

Abstract:Agricultural automatic guidance is one of important symbols of automation of agriculture.Image segmentation has become crucial in Agricultural machinery guidance.According to the difference between cut and uncut crops textural,this article explored an wavelet transform way in automatic segmentation of crop images,and carried through a great deal of experiments.Effect and efficiency also had been compared between the wavelet transform way and the Laws texture energy statistical way.Both theory analysis and experimental results show that the wavelet based segmentation is effective and practicable.
